Main information about car part NPS 401503037071
Producer NPS
Number 401503037071
Description Oil Filter
Analogue of NPS 401503037071
ASHUKI ASHUKI T093-01 T09301 Oil Filter
NPS NPS T131A01 T131A01 Oil Filter
The other parts with the same number "401503037071"
OE 401503037071 Oil Filter
TOYOTA 401503037071 Oil Filter
LEXUS 40150 30370-71 Oil Filter